I think they are the same bar but one has 25.4mm(001) and the other has 26mm clamp.
https://www.tokyofixedgear.com/shopexd.asp?id=2408
https://www.benscycle.net/index.php?m...d=6a007446e...
If this is true, this would explain the stem uses on both bikes yummy linked above. The person with the 001 is using a Thomso Elite x4 and the person with 002 is using a Dimension, a 26mm stem.
https://www.tokyofixedgear.com/shopexd.asp?id=2408
https://www.benscycle.net/index.php?m...d=6a007446e...
If this is true, this would explain the stem uses on both bikes yummy linked above. The person with the 001 is using a Thomso Elite x4 and the person with 002 is using a Dimension, a 26mm stem.
001 = 25.4mm clamp, 380mm width
002 = 26mm clamp, 370mm width
Personally, I love my RB002s. They were pricy, but i'll probably keep them for as long as I ride fixed.
